CAS 23511-50-4
:2-chloro-N-cycloheptylacetamide
Description:
2-Chloro-N-cycloheptylacetamide is an organic compound characterized by its amide functional group, which consists of a carbonyl group (C=O) directly attached to a nitrogen atom (N). The presence of a chloro substituent indicates that a chlorine atom is bonded to the second carbon of the acetamide structure, while the cycloheptyl group, a seven-membered carbon ring, is attached to the nitrogen atom. This compound is typically a solid at room temperature and is soluble in organic solvents, reflecting its polar amide nature. Its chemical structure suggests potential applications in medicinal chemistry, particularly in the development of pharmaceuticals, due to the presence of both the chloro and cycloheptyl groups, which can influence biological activity and interaction with biological targets. Additionally, the compound may exhibit specific reactivity patterns typical of amides, such as undergoing hydrolysis or participating in coupling reactions. Safety data should be consulted for handling and storage, as with any chemical substance, to ensure proper laboratory practices.
Formula:C9H16ClNO
InChI:InChI=1/C9H16ClNO/c10-7-9(12)11-8-5-3-1-2-4-6-8/h8H,1-7H2,(H,11,12)
SMILES:C1CCCC(CC1)N=C(CCl)O
Synonyms:- acetamide, 2-chloro-N-cycloheptyl-
- 2-Chloro-N-cycloheptylacetamide
